Ultra practical multimeter usage guide

Today, I have compiled a highly practical guide for using a multimeter. From preparation and measurement essentials to safety taboos and storage methods, I will explain step by step,

Even beginners can easily get started by following the instructions, and experienced electricians can also identify and fill in gaps!

First of all, let me tell you that a digital multimeter has a wide range of functions, including measuring AC/DC voltage, AC/DC current, resistance, capacitance, inductance, as well as frequency

Wen

Degree, bipolar parameters, built-in data retention, backlight illumination, fully sufficient for daily electrical work.

150618f6dz5tb06itabdrk.jpg.webp

Preparation before measurement

1. Check the appearance: First, check whether the multimeter casing and probe insulation are damaged, and whether the metal parts are exposed to avoid leakage; Turn the gear knob again

Check if it is clear, if there is any jamming, and ensure that the gear can be switched normally.

1. Measure voltage (AC V~/DC V -) 2. Measure current (A)

Insert the black probe into the COM hole and the red probe into the V/S hole; Turn the gear knob to ACV or DCV mode, estimate the voltage being measured first, and if unsure, select the highest

File, avoid burning the watch; Touch the two probes separately to the test point, and the display screen will show the voltage value. If it shows overflow, switch to a higher gear and test again.

Insert the black probe into the COM port, and the red probe into the A port based on the current. If the estimated current is between 200mA and 10A, insert it into the 10A port. Otherwise, insert it into the A port; Shift to gear

In ACA or DCA mode, connect the multimeter in series with the measured branch to see the current value; Remember to insert the red probe back into the V/S hole after measuring, don't forget!

3. Measure resistance ()

Cut off the power supply of the circuit first, discharge the capacitor, and avoid errors in live measurement; Insert the black probe into the COM hole, the red probe into the V/S hole, and shift the gear to the desired resistance level,

Connect the probe across the measured resistor, being careful not to touch the metal part of the probe with your fingers, as it may affect the measurement result. When the input is open, the display screen will show "1" or

OL ": If the measured resistance is above 1MO, it takes a few seconds to read the stable value.

4. Measuring diodes

5. Measure capacitance (C)

Cut off the power supply and discharge the capacitor first; Insert the black probe into the COM hole, the red probe into the V/S hole, shift the gear to the diode symbol, and the red probe contacts the tested object

Point. If values around 0.3 and 0.8V are displayed, it indicates that the diode is functioning properly; If reversed, it will display an out of range status.

First, short-circuit and discharge the two pins of the capacitor to prevent electric shock; Switch the gear to the desired capacitance range and connect the measured capacitance to a CX "or" Cx Lx "socket with polarity

Capacitors should be connected correctly according to the markings; The reading of large capacity capacitors will be slower, just be patient and wait for stability.

3、 Safety taboos

1. It is strictly prohibited to use current holes to measure voltage or use resistance settings to measure live circuits, as it can easily burn the multimeter and even cause electric shock,

2. It is strictly prohibited to shift gears during the measurement process. The probe must be removed before shifting gears.

When measuring high current (10A), it is necessary to measure and release quickly, and the time should not exceed 10 seconds to prevent the multimeter from overheating and damage.

4、 Readings and maintenance

1. The reading should be read after the display screen stabilizes. If unsure, use the HOLD key to lock the reading to avoid reading errors.

2. If the battery voltage is found to be too low, replace it with a new battery in a timely manner, otherwise the measurement results may be inaccurate and the instrument may be damaged.

5、 Save method

1. After the measurement is completed, turn the range knob to the highest AC voltage level to prevent operational errors from burning the meter during the next measurement.

If not used for a long time, be sure to remove the battery to avoid deterioration, leakage, and damage to the internal circuit board.
